Action 14:存款
功能说明
- 当玩家离开游戏时呼叫该 API,通知此玩家的当前余额、总押注金额及总赢分。
- 若收到请求且此笔请求已处理成功过,请回传
0000
。 - 当呼叫该 API 失败时,JDB 将每分钟重送一次,直到回应 status
0000
或已重送达 12 个小时。

请求参数
参数 | 格式 | 说明 |
---|---|---|
action | Integer | 14 |
ts | Long | 当前系统时间 |
transferId | Long | 交易序号 |
uid | String(50) | 玩家账号 |
currency | String(10) | 参照附录:货币代码 |
amount | Double | 要返还给玩家的金额(永远为正数) |
refTransferIds | Array of Long | 此次存款与哪些提款相关;对应至 Action 13 的 transferId |
totalBet | Double | 玩家此次游戏期间的总押注金额 |
totalWin | Double | 玩家此次游戏期间的总游戏赢分 |
gType | Integer | 游戏类型 参照附录 游戏提供商 |
mType | Integer | 机台类型 |
systemSessionId | String(150) | 系统阶段唯一码,每次 action 21 取得游戏连结会获得不同值。 游戏类型支援范围:捕鱼机(7) 预设无此参数,如需要请洽业务人员 |
接续上面表格,以下将依 gType 分类,列出对应的参数表格
请求范例
{
"action": 14,
"ts": 1664521584150,
"transferId": 251917,
"uid": "testpl",
"currency": "RM",
"amount": 5285.0,
"refTransferIds": [
252925
],
"totalBet": 300.0,
"totalWin": 300.0,
"gType": 0,
"mType": 8001
}
返回参数
参数 | 格式 | 说明 |
---|---|---|
status | String(4) | 成功:0000其余错误代码视同交易失败,将再次重送 |
err_text | String(255) | 错误讯息 |
返回范例
{
"status": "0000",
"err_text": ""
}